You should create a set of discs for recovering your 
pre-installed software and device drivers, in case you need to 
use them later for a complete system recovery. (Your computer 
must have a recordable disc drive to perform this procedure.)
To create discs for recovering pre-installed software 
and drivers:
 
1
Click (Start), All ProgramsGateway Recovery 
Center
, then click Gateway Recovery Center. The 
Gateway Recovery Center opens.
2
Click Applications and drivers external media, then 
click Next. The What would you like to do? dialog box 
opens.
3
Click Create system recovery discs, then click Next.
4
Insert a blank, recordable disc into a recordable disc 
drive, then click Next. If an AutoPlay dialog box opens, 
click the x in the upper-right corner to close it.
A dialog box opens that tells you the number of blank 
discs you need to create a full set of recovery discs.
